阿里云服务器系统日志深度解析与高效管理,是确保服务器稳定运行和及时排查问题的关键,通过阿里云提供的日志服务,可以方便地查看、分析和管理服务器日志,需要了解日志的分类和格式,以便快速定位问题,利用日志分析工具进行深度解析,可以提取关键信息并生成可视化报告,帮助用户更好地了解服务器运行状态,通过配置日志告警和自动化运维工具,可以实现高效管理,及时发现并处理潜在问题,掌握阿里云服务器系统日志的查看和管理方法,对于保障服务器稳定性和提升运维效率具有重要意义。
在云计算日益普及的今天,阿里云作为行业领先的云服务提供商,其服务器系统日志成为了运维人员监控、诊断及优化系统性能的重要工具,本文旨在深入探讨阿里云服务器系统日志的构成、重要性、如何有效管理以及如何利用这些日志提升运维效率,确保服务器稳定运行。
阿里云服务器系统日志概述
阿里云服务器系统日志,是指运行于阿里云服务器上的操作系统、应用程序及云服务组件在运行时产生的记录文件,包括但不限于登录信息、系统错误、软件安装与更新记录、网络请求与响应等,这些日志是了解服务器健康状况、追踪问题根源、实施安全审计的关键资源。
系统日志的重要性
- 故障排查:当服务器出现故障或性能下降时,系统日志能迅速提供错误代码、异常信息等关键线索,帮助运维人员定位问题原因,缩短故障解决时间。
- 安全审计:通过监控登录尝试、异常访问等日志,可以及时发现并响应安全威胁,保障服务器安全。
- 性能优化:分析系统日志中的资源使用情况、网络流量等,可以识别性能瓶颈,指导资源分配和配置优化。
- 合规性:对于需要遵循特定法规的行业(如金融、医疗),系统日志是证明合规性的重要依据。
如何有效管理阿里云服务器系统日志
日志收集与集中管理
- 使用阿里云日志服务(SLS):SLS提供了强大的日志收集、存储、查询与分析能力,支持从多个源(如ECS实例、容器服务等)实时收集日志,并自动进行索引,便于高效检索和分析。
- 配置Logtail:对于自定义应用日志,可通过部署Logtail Agent实现日志的自动收集与传输至SLS,确保所有相关日志被统一管理和分析。
日志分类与标签化
- 对不同类型的日志进行清晰分类,如“系统错误”、“用户操作”、“应用日志”等,便于后续快速定位和筛选。
- 使用标签(Tag)对重要或特定事件进行标记,如“紧急”、“安全事件”等,提高处理优先级。
日志存储与备份策略
- 合理设置日志保留期限,避免占用过多存储空间,根据业务需求,设置适当的日志滚动策略(如按时间或大小分割日志文件)。
- 定期备份重要日志文件至安全位置,以防数据丢失。
日志分析与监控
- 利用SLS提供的查询语言(SQL-like)对日志进行复杂分析,如统计某个时间段内的错误数量、追踪特定用户的行为轨迹等。
- 结合阿里云监控服务(CMS),设置告警规则,当特定日志模式出现时自动触发通知,提高响应速度。
提升运维效率的实践案例
快速定位性能瓶颈
某电商平台在高峰期遭遇服务器响应延迟问题,通过分析系统日志中的CPU使用率、内存占用情况、网络带宽利用率等信息,发现是由于数据库查询压力过大导致,随后,通过优化SQL查询语句、增加缓存策略及调整数据库配置,有效缓解了性能瓶颈。
安全事件响应
一次夜间,某服务器的系统日志中突然出现大量失败的SSH登录尝试,通过SLS快速检索相关日志,发现疑似暴力破解行为,立即封锁IP并加强账户安全策略,有效阻止了潜在的安全威胁。
总结与展望
阿里云服务器系统日志是运维工作中不可或缺的一部分,其有效管理与利用对于提升运维效率、保障系统安全稳定至关重要,随着AI和大数据技术的发展,未来阿里云将进一步融合智能分析工具,如自动化故障预测、智能告警等,使运维人员能够更加高效地进行日常管理和应急处理,加强合规性管理和隐私保护也是未来发展的重要方向,充分利用阿里云提供的强大日志服务,将极大提升云服务的管理水平和运维效率。